PT/OT/ST Billing to Colorado Medicaid

I have recently started working as a coder/biller for a PT/OT/ST pediatric company. The previous biller did not stay up to date with NCCI edits. When I get denials from Medicaid because of the NCCI edits it is not always consistent. Sometimes they will pay a code set they previously denied. Has anyone else ran into these kinds of issues? I was also wondering if there are any local groups for coders/billers of PT/OT/ST that meet occasionally to go over all of the constant changes with Colorado Medicaid? How To Get A Colorado Medical Marijuana Card

In order to get a Colorado Medical Marijuana Card you must have a qualifying condition. Under Colorado law some qualifying conditions include but are not limited to:

AIDS/HIV

Arthritis

Asthma

Cachexia

Cancer

Crohn’s Disease

Chronic Muscle Spasms

Chronic Nausea

Chronic Pain

Degenerative Disk Disease

Epilepsy

Fibromyalgia

Glaucoma

GERD

Hepatitis C

IBS (Irritable Bowel Syndrome)

Migraines

Multiple Sclerosis

Parkinson’s Disease

Seizures
